What can I see and do near Villa La Angostura Ski Resort?
Lounge by the water at Puerto Manzano Beach and Escondida Beach. At Rio Correntoso, Brava Bay and Los Arrayanes National Park, you can surround yourself with nature. If you want to see more of the surrounding area, you might plan a visit to Incayal Waterfall and Virgen Nina Chapel.
